Description
The NI-9426 is a C Series Digital I/O module designed to meet the needs of a wide range of digital input applications. It comes in two versions: the Conformal Coated version with a part number of 780030-01, and the Non-Conformal Coated version with a part number of 780030-02. This module is specifically designed for sourcing digital input signals, as indicated by its full description, the NI 9426 w/DSub Sourcing Digital Input Module, Conformal Coat.
The module features 32 digital input channels, accommodating a variety of signal types. The input voltage threshold is greater than 1.9 V, with an input current requirement of over 65 μA. It boasts an input impedance of 30 kΩ (±5%), ensuring reliable signal detection and processing. The NI-9426 is capable of a maximum update time of just 7 μs, allowing for high-speed data acquisition and control applications.
Regarding electrical specifications, the Vsup-to-Channel Voltage must not exceed 30 VDC maximum, ensuring the module’s protection against higher voltages. Power consumption is optimized for efficiency, consuming 615 mW during active operation and dropping to a mere 5 mW in sleep mode. This module utilizes a 37-pin D-SUB connector, providing a robust and reliable connection for data transmission.
The NI-9426 is built to operate in demanding environments, with an operating temperature range of -40 °C to 70 °C and a storage temperature range of -40 °C to 85 °C. It can function within an operating humidity range of 10% RH to 90% RH (non-condensing) and a storage humidity range of 5% RH to 95% RH (non-condensing). | Specification | Detail |
|---|---|
| Part Number (Conformal Coated) | 780030-01 |
| Part Number (Non-Conformal Coated) | 780030-02 |
| Category | C Series Digital I/O |
| Model | NI-9426 |
| Description | NI 9426 w/DSub Sourcing Digital Input Module, Conformal Coat |
| Digital Input Channels | 32 |
| Input Voltage | >1.9 V |
| Input Current | >65 μA |
| Input Impedance | 30 kΩ (±5%) |
| Maximum Update Time | 7 μs |
| Vsup-to-Channel Voltage | 30 VDC maximum |
| Power Consumption (Active/Sleep) | 615 mW / 5 mW |
| Connector Type | 37-pin D-SUB |
| Operating Temperature Range | -40 °C to 70 °C |
| Storage Temperature Range | -40 °C to 85 °C |
| Operating Humidity Range | 10% RH to 90% RH (non-condensing) |
| Storage Humidity Range | 5% RH to 95% RH (non-condensing) |
| Operating Vibration (Random) | 5 grms (10 to 500 Hz) |
| Operating Vibration (Sinusoidal) | 5 g (10 to 500 Hz) |
